Game Recap: Men's Soccer |

Grove City edged in semis

GROVE CITY, Pa. -- The Grove City College men's soccer team closed the spring 2021 season Tuesday night by dropping a 2-1 decision to visiting Washington & Jefferson in the semifinals of the Presidents' Athletic Conference Championship Tournament at Don Lyle Field.

Grove City (7-2) broke through at 89:57 when junior midfielder Bryce Deaven (Newport, Pa./Greenwood) scored in front of the goal area. Junior defender Drew Yun (Roseburg, Ore./Roseburg) assisted Deaven's goal, his first score of the season.

The Wolverines appeared to take a 1-0 lead at 8:17 when sophomore forward Mark Guinta (Fairfield, Conn./Christian Heritage) beat W&J goalie Samuel Miller. However, an offside violation negated the goal.

Third-seeded W&J (7-2-1) broke a scoreless tie at 51:11 when Jake Fetterman scored. Jayden Da boosted the lead to 2-0 when he scored at 73:54. Da also assisted Fetterman's goal.

W&J held an 11-7 edge in shots. Each team had three corner kicks. Junior goalkeeper Luke Greenway (Penn Hills, Pa./Penn Hills) stopped four shots for Grove City while Miller made two saves.

Grove City will lose seniors Jeffrey Biddle (Grove City, Pa./Grove City), Wyatt Grimm (Volant, Pa./Grove City) and Seth Wade (Winchester, Va./Sherando) to graduation. The Wolverines project to return 10 starters for the fall season, which will begin in August.
